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Pad: Larger pads require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Thickness of the Concrete: Thicker pads are more durable but also more expensive due to the additional concrete required.
  • Site Preparation: Costs can vary based on the amount of excavation, grading, and preparation needed before pouring the concrete.
  • Reinforcement: Adding rebar or wire mesh for additional strength can increase costs.
  • Type of Concrete: Specialized concrete mixes, such as high-strength or decorative options, can be more expensive.
  • Labor Costs: Labor rates in Eugene, OR, can vary, affecting the overall cost of the project.
  • Permits and Inspections: Fees for necessary permits and inspections can add to the total cost.
  •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ay the project and increase costs due to additional labor and materials needed to protect the work site.

Task Average Cost (Eugene, OR)
Basic Concrete Pad (10x10 ft, 4 inches thick) $800 - $1,200
High-Strength Concrete Pad $1,200 - $1,800
Decorative Concrete (stamped or colored) $1,500 - $2,500
Site Preparation (grading and excavation) $500 - $1,000
Reinforcement (rebar or wire mesh) $200 - $400
Permit and Inspection Fees $100 - $300
